What is AI? Simply put, it is the simulation of human intelligence processes by machines, especially computer systems. Why should you as a South African youth care about AI? Well, because it’s embedded in almost everything you do and use! When you are recommended a new show to watch on Netflix, it’s AI, when your phone identifies faces in photos, that is AI, when you use Google Maps, it is AI offering real-time traffic updates. YES, it is AI that personalises your feed on Instagram, Facebook, and Tinder, showing you content that it has calculated aligns with your interests and behaviour. I decided to have some fun with ChatGPT, a new and popular artificial intelligence chatbot that uses natural language processing to create humanlike conversational dialogue. I inputted questions, also known as “Prompts”. If you want to get better-quality, more precise answers from AI, you need to tweak the prompt, this is called “prompt engineering”.
